Beauty businesses need digital support that understands the industry

Beauty and wellness businesses have their own rhythm.

Appointments, treatments, preparation time, service duration, hair length, deposits, cancellations, consultations, client expectations and repeat bookings all play an important role.

A generic website or booking setup does not always reflect that.

For example, a hair treatment may depend on hair length. A service may need a consultation first. A client may need to understand the difference between treatments before booking. A salon may need clear cancellation policies to protect valuable time.

These details matter.

When the digital setup does not match the real workflow of the business, both the owner and the client can feel the friction.

A digital partner is more than a web designer

A web designer can create a beautiful page.

A digital partner looks at the bigger picture.

A digital partner asks:

Is the website clear for the client?
Can people book easily from mobile?
Are the services explained properly?
Are prices, durations and policies easy to understand?
Does the website build trust?
Is the business ready for online payments?
Can the salon grow without creating more chaos?

This is the kind of support many beauty entrepreneurs need.

Not just design. Not just technology. Not just marketing advice.

They need someone who can connect the dots.
